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
059156 947958419 738434 26 37768616589
15524740865 31739837 617
15524740865 31739837 617
65588 88 769604 80288 2882675
All about undefined
Interested in learning more?
15524740865 31739837 617
65588 88 769604 80288 2882675
See more
47 562 9634201900
676 4799267020 9634
See more
3644030 6839852 6212153114
9128010 10529607152 834677
See more